Common Estate Planning Legal Issues Faced by Residents

Residents of Washington, PA, often encounter several common estate planning challenges. One prevalent issue is determining how to best allocate assets among heirs. Families may face disputes over property division, especially if there are blended families or estranged relationships. Another concern is the establishment of trusts to manage assets for minor children or dependent adults. Additionally, individuals often grapple with deciding on healthcare proxies and durable power of attorney designations to ensure their wishes are respected in the event of incapacity.

Moreover, tax implications can be a significant concern for many residents. Understanding federal and state tax laws, especially concerning inheritance and estate taxes, is crucial to efficient estate planning. Many individuals may overlook these details, leading to unnecessary tax burdens for their beneficiaries.

Local Case Examples or Situations

Consider the fictional case of the Johnson family in Washington. After the passing of the family patriarch, tensions arose among the surviving family members regarding the distribution of the family home. The father had verbally expressed his wishes to his children but failed to document them legally. Consequently, the lack of a will resulted in disputes, court involvement, and ultimately a lengthy and painful process to settle the estate.

In another situation, the Smiths, a couple in their late 50s, decided to create a revocable living trust after witnessing the struggles of a friend who faced probate litigation. They consulted with a local estate planning lawyer who guided them through the complexities of trust creation, ensuring that their assets would be managed effectively and passed on to their children with minimal tax implications.

These scenarios highlight the importance of seeking legal assistance in estate planning to avoid common pitfalls and facilitate smoother transitions for heirs.

Typical Lawyer Fees and How They Vary in This ZIP

The cost of hiring an estate planning lawyer in the 15301 ZIP code can vary widely depending on several factors, including the lawyer's experience, the complexity of the estate, and the specific services required. Generally, flat fees for basic estate planning documents—such as wills, trusts, and powers of attorney—can range from $300 to $1,500. More complex cases, such as those involving significant assets or business interests, may incur higher costs, often charged on an hourly basis at rates ranging from $150 to $400 per hour.

Residents should also consider additional costs, such as court filing fees or fees for asset appraisals, which may contribute to overall expenses. It's crucial to discuss fees upfront with your attorney to avoid any surprises.

Why Hiring a Local Lawyer Helps

Engaging a local estate planning lawyer in Washington, PA, offers several advantages. Local attorneys possess an in-depth understanding of Pennsylvania's estate laws and regulations, ensuring that your estate plan complies with state requirements. Moreover, a local lawyer can provide personalized attention and readily address any unique aspects of your situation, such as family dynamics or specific assets.

Additionally, local lawyers are often well-connected within the community, which can be beneficial when it comes to referrals for other professionals, such as financial advisors or tax specialists. Their familiarity with local courts and procedures also means that they can navigate the legal system more efficiently, saving you time and stress.
